Alyssa Milano's Career Journey
Alyssa Milano's career is a testament to her longevity in the entertainment industry. She began acting at a very young age and has, you know, consistently worked in television and film for decades, which is quite impressive, really.
Early Roles and Rise to Fame
Before "Charmed," Alyssa was a household name thanks to her role as Samantha Micelli on the popular sitcom "Who's the Boss?" This show gave her early exposure and, in some respects, cemented her place as a young star. She then moved on to more mature roles, including a memorable run on "Melrose Place," where she showed a different side of her acting abilities, so.
These early experiences shaped her as an actress and prepared her for the demands of a show like "Charmed." She learned, basically, how to navigate the pressures of fame and the long hours of television production from a very young age, which is, you know, a unique kind of education in itself.
Post-Charmed Projects
After "Charmed" concluded, Alyssa Milano continued to work steadily. She appeared in various television series, including "Mistresses" and "Insatiable," showcasing her range in different genres. She has also taken on roles in films and, you know, expanded her work into other areas, such as writing and activism, too.
Her career trajectory shows a consistent dedication to her craft and a willingness to explore new opportunities. She has, in a way, maintained a strong public presence, often using her platform to advocate for various causes she believes in, which is, you know, quite commendable. Julian McMahon's Professional Path
Julian McMahon has also enjoyed a successful and varied career, with notable roles both before and after his time on "Charmed." He often gravitates towards characters with a certain edge or complexity, which he portrays with a compelling intensity, so.
Pre-Charmed Acting Roles
Before stepping into the role of Cole Turner, Julian McMahon had already made a name for himself in television. He was known for his role as Detective John Grant in the crime drama "Profiler," where he, you know, showcased his ability to play a serious and commanding character. He also had a stint on the popular Australian soap opera "Home and Away," which gave him early exposure, too.
These roles helped him build a solid foundation as an actor, preparing him for the demands of a high-profile show like "Charmed." He brought a certain gravitas to his characters, which, in some respects, made him stand out in the roles he took on.
Later Career Choices
After his departure from "Charmed," Julian McMahon continued to secure prominent roles in both television and film. He starred in the hit series "Nip/Tuck," playing the charismatic and often morally ambiguous plastic surgeon Christian Troy, which earned him significant acclaim. He also took on film roles, including portraying Doctor Doom in the "Fantastic Four" movies, so.
His career since "Charmed" has shown a consistent pattern of choosing diverse and interesting characters. He has, in a way, maintained a strong presence in the acting world, demonstrating his enduring appeal and talent, which is, you know, quite evident in his body of work.
